Output 34bf90ab256770f0c46a8b6023b6afa21547cbca61086a4302d4bd028c596692:0

value
2795687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9789b173a26c65408bbceaaf972795d5f585ad7 OP_EQUAL
address
3L4JDwYMHVQDjkTDP8sD2NBdjC6C2iLX7y
transaction
34bf90ab256770f0c46a8b6023b6afa21547cbca61086a4302d4bd028c596692